Verbal self defense,repparttar use of your voice in a threatening situation, is an extremely important tool in protecting yourself. How? Uncommon to popular belief, criminals do not pounce on an individual whenrepparttar 130317 mood strikes them. They attack when they see an opportunity available to them. If it’s easy, they will take it. They will prey on those who are weak, unaware, and an uncomplicated target. Criminals will act on premeditation, or stalk their victims ahead of time before attacking. If you show that you are familiar with your surroundings, walk with confidence, and give offrepparttar 130318 impression of strength, a criminal will not want to work to fight you.

Keep you eyes on everyone. Just because they might not ‘look’ like an attacker, doesn’t mean that some guy in a business suit can’t be one. If someone is approaching you, look them inrepparttar 130319 eye, hold out your hands in front of you and yell “Stay Back!” or “Stop!” Most sexual assailants interviewed say that they leave a woman alone if she showed that she wasn’t someone to be messed with or wasn’t afraid to fight back.

It’s called putting up a verbal boundary or verbal self defense. Many who have used this as part of their self defense training say they were amazed when they stepped toward a threatening stranger and yelled “Back Off!” in a strong, assertive, projecting voice. Andrepparttar 130320 would-be assailant did just that.

Using pepper sprays can work inrepparttar 130321 same manner. Just by aiming at a potential attacker and yelling, “I have pepper spray!” can be a deterrent. That’s if it is in your hand atrepparttar 130322 time.

Pepper sprays are only effective if properly used. Telling your would-be assailant that you have pepper spray… and it’s atrepparttar 130323 bottom of your purse is not effectively using it, or any weapon or self-defense product, for that matter. A jewelry box isrepparttar perfect companion to all your beautiful jewelry pieces. You can use it not only for keeping your ornaments but also for storing those precious trinkets and items which you care for very deeply.

There are some things which cannot be evaluated in terms of money, these are small fragile things which in some way have touched your life and are of immense significance. A jewelry box is a safe haven for all those little things. A place where you can keep those small treasures which cannot be bought with money.

A good jewelry box is most often a beautiful handcrafted piece. It is available in various finishes and textures. Starting from warm mahogany wood, rose wood, to matt silver, there is a jewelry box in almost every conceivable material and color. Some of these materials used forrepparttar 130316 creation of your jewelry box include wood, glass, metal, and porcelain. The one that most are accustomed to isrepparttar 130317 wooden flip top lids withrepparttar 130318 musical song that lightly plays inrepparttar 130319 background. However, there have been changes and improvements inrepparttar 130320 making of a jewelry box, and there are now very beautifully made wooden jewelry boxes made from dark cherry wood, and there is now also style of jewelry box that is being made from carved and polished marble.

You can choose from a very wide range and pick one which suits your taste and pocket atrepparttar 130321 same time. The jewelry box has a soft lining of velvet inside, such thatrepparttar 130322 precious things you store in it are not damaged in any way. Some are antique pieces, which have been crafted by master craftsmen and are collector's items. Others are made by established firms who specialize only in making these. Still others can be found at local stores made by individual craftsmen or by bulk manufacturers.
